    Computerized Municipal Utility System Mapping

    Source: Journal of Surveying Engineering:;1984:;Volume ( 110 ):;issue: 001
    Author:
    John E. Schaefer
    DOI: 10.1061/(ASCE)0733-9453(1984)110:1(8)
    Publisher: American Society of Civil Engineers
    Abstract: Accurate and complete information on underground municipal utility systems becomes increasingly important and difficult to maintain as cities grow and the urban infrastructure becomes more complicated. It is desirable to know the use, location, depth, size, material, age, active status, and ownership of every component of every underground utility system occupying public right‐of‐way. Such information is needed for operation and maintenance as well as for planning new construction. A scheme is presented for tabulating positional, functional, descriptive, historic, operational, and ownership information on utility system elements and sub‐surface structures in a format amenable to computerized data management. Grid coordinates and elevations are used for location. Coding schemes are suggested to convey other information. The advantages and disadvantages of the proposed scheme and considerations of implementation are discussed.
